What I feel is a company can not be a fool to mention a grauity payment (for which you will be eligible when you leave the company...the future amount) in your CTC. What they must have mentioned is grauity contribution which is 15 days salary (basic+DA) that an employer contribute every year in the grauity fund towards its liability for the payment of gratuity to its employees.



You can easily calculate your 15 days fixed salary and the gratuity amount they have mentioned in your offer letter. It should not be more than your 15 days (basic+DA) salary.



Gratuity contribuition cannot be deducted from employee's salary. It is employer's liability and there is nothing wrong either legally or ethically if the employer is considering it as a part of your CTC.

When we discuss about CTC/Salary need to understand the difference between deduction and contribution.
Deduction is wrong...Contribution can not be termed as wrong.
Making gratuity a salary component is unfortunate.
Gratuity is not only employer's gratitude (at will) towards its employees ...its a statutory obligation of the employer also.
